The grey-chested dove (Leptotila cassinii) is a species of bird in the family Columbidae.
It is found in Belize, Colombia, Costa Rica, Guatemala, Honduras, Mexico, Nicaragua, and Panama. Its natural habitats are subtropical or tropical moist lowland forests and heavily degraded former forest.
Description
It has a grey chest with brown wings and tail and red feet.
